 HIGH POWER RESISTOR - 20W to 140W
The content of this specification may change without notification 12/07/07 Custom solutions are available.
HOW TO ORDER RHP-10A-100 F Y R
Packaging (50 pieces) T = tube or R= tray (flanged type only) TCR (ppm/C) Y = +50 Z = +100 N = +250 Tolerance J = +5% F = +1% Resistance R02 = 0.02 R10 = 0.10 1R0 = 1.00 100 = 10.0 101 = 100 512 = 51.0K 100A
FEATURES
20W, 35W, 50W, 100W, and 140W available TO126, TO220, TO263, TO247 packaging Surface Mount and Through Hole technology Resistance Tolerance from 5% to 1% TCR (ppm/C) from 250ppm to 50ppm Complete thermal flow design Non-Inductive impedance characteristic and heat venting through the insulated metal tab Durable design with complete thermal conduction, heat dissipation, and vibration
APPLICATIONS
RF circuit termination resistors CRT color video amplifiers Suits high-density compact installations High precision CRT and high speed pulse handling circuit High speed SW power supply Power unit of machines VHF amplifiers Motor control Industrial computers Drive circuits IPM, SW power supply Automotive Volt power sources Measurements Constant current sources AC motor control Industrial RF power RF linear amplifiers Precision voltage sources Custom Solutions are Available - For more information, send your specification tosales@aacix.com.

OVERVIEW
Model Physical (top & bottom view) Features TO126 Package 20W high power resistor 5.9 C/W heat resistance from hot spot to flange. 0.10 ohm to 220 ohm resistance range
RHP-10X
RPH-10B
TO220 Package Through hole RHP-10B 20W high power 5.9 C/W heat resistance from hot spot to flange via thin film metallization technology 0.10 ohm to 220 ohm resistance range TO220 Package Surface mount RHP-10C 10W high power 5.9 C/W heat resistance from hot spot to flange via thin film metallization technology 0.10 ohm to 220 ohm resistance range
RHP-10C
RHP-20B
TO220 Package Through hole RHP-20B 35W high power 3.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.02 ohm to 220 ohm resistance range
RHP-20C
TO220 Package Surface mount RHP-20C 20W 3.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.02 ohm to 220 ohm resistance range TO263 (D2P) Package - Surface Mount Molded 20W high power resistor 3.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.01 ohm to 51K ohm resistance range
RHP-20D
RHP-50A
TO247 Package 100W high power resistor 1.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.01 ohm to 220 ohm resistance range
RHP-50B
TO220 Package Through hole RHP-50B 50W high power 2.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.10 ohm to 220 ohm resistance range
RHP-50C
TO220 Package Surface mount RHP-50C 50W high power 2.3 C/W heat resistance from hot spot to flange via thin film metallization technology 0.10 ohm to 220 ohm resistance range TO247 Package 140W high power resistor 0.9 C/W heat resistance from hot spot to flange or metal back plate. via thin film metallization technology 0.02 ohm to 220 ohm resistance range
RHP-100A

NOTES
GENERAL 1. 0.1% tolerance resistors and resistance range from 240 ohm to 51K ohm are available as a semi-custom solution 2. Use of heat conduction grease on surface of flange is recommended. 3. Insulation material is unnecessary between flange and resistors; the flange and resistor are separated by alumina substrate. 4. It surface mount soldering, temperature profile in the flange shall not exceed 220C. 5. Heat sink design will be performed when the resistor operating temperature is less than 155C RHP-10X 1. Heat resistance between resistor and flange is 3.6K/W 2. For application to r-f circuit, Lead formed RHP-10X (smd) is prepared; RHP-10X are screw mount style. 3. At resistance from 220 to 51kohms rating power shall be restricted in 10W.
RHP-10B, RHP-10C 1. Heat resistance between resistor and flange is 5.9 C/W. RHP-20B, RHP-20C 1. Heat resistance between resistor and flange is 3.3 C/W 2. At resistance from 220 to 51kohms rating power shall be restricted in 20W. 3. The terminal material is Tin plated copper, but inside of resistor contains PbAg high melting solder that is exempted by RoHS directive 2002/95/EC. RHP-20D 1. At flange soldering, temperature profile in flange shall not exceed 270C for 30 minutes. 2. Heat resistance between resistor and flange is 3.3C/W. 3. This model shall be fit to Copper of printed wiring board with lower temperature solder than 220C. Sn-Cu soldering will be done by soldering iron with 300C -350C tip temperature for less than 30 minutes. RHP-50A 1. Using heat conduction grease on surface of flange is recommended. 2. Heat resistance between resistor and flange is 1.3 K/W. Heat design will be done, as resistor temperature shall be under 155C in operation. RHP-50B, RHP-50-C 1. Heat resistance between resistor and flange is 3.3 C/W. 2. 5ppm TCR resistors are available as a semi-custom product 3. At resistance from 220 to 51kohms rating power shall be restricted in 30W. 4. Please note, terminal material is Tin plated copper, but inside of resistor contains PbAg high melting solder that is exempted by RoHS directive 2002/95/EC. RHP-100A Recommendation 1. Flat surface heat sink, thermal compound and sufficient mount screw torque will be necessary for good heat transfer. 2. In a rush current protection application, such as charge current limitation resistor, sufficient power derating will be necessary.
